School Overview

Cajon Park Elementary is a public school located in Santee, California. It is a school in Santee School District district.

According to the California state assessment result, 44% of students are proficient in Math learning and 53%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 1,002 students through grade KG to 8. The students to teacher ratio is 29 to 1 where a total of 34 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 34 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Cajon Park Elementary and the students to teacher ratio is 29 to 1. All teachers are certified. 82.4%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
